COOLER DOOR SPECIFICATIONS
- Supply where indicated on
plans Jamison Firetemp
Manually Operated Single Leaf Horizontal
Sliding Cooler Fire Door. Door
Leaf to be metal clad with #20
gauge galvanized steel
front and back. Internal structure of
door to be steel channel.
- Door to be filled with 4" (101.6mm) Jamison specially
formulated
fire resistant insulation with an R value
of 17 at 40° F
(4½°C).
- Gaskets at sides and head to be adjustable
copolymer
material, sill gasket on door to be sweep
type.
- Hardware and track to have protective coating
against
corrosion.
- Door to be equipped with fusible link counterweighted
closing
mechanism.
FREEZER DOOR SPECIFICATIONS
Freezer door specifications to be same as
cooler
door except for these substitutions and
additions:
- Supply where indicated on
plans Jamison Firetemp
Manually Operated Single Leaf Horizontal
Sliding Freezer Door.
- Metal cladding on warm side of door to be applied
with all seams and all bolt holes sealed.
- Provide heater cables in top,
sides, and bottom of
door. Complete device to be assembled, ready
for connection to 120 volt, 60
Hertz (50 Hertz available), single phase AC line.
SPECIAL NOTES:
- Firetemp Freezer door is designed for installation in rooms with
temperatures above +32° F
(0°C). If door must be mounted in rooms with temperatures of +32°
F (0°C) and below, contact BMIL International.
- When cold rooms temperature is below -20°
F (-29°C) and/or the relative humidity is greater than 80%
on the warm side, heater cables should be added to the frame/gasket
assembly.
- If the freezer room temperature is below -40°
F (-40°C) or if the temperature difference exceeds 90°
F (50°C), contact BMIL International.
OPTIONS: (SPECIFY which options
are desired):
- Metal cladding can be stainless steel
(type
430) or painted steel.
M.I.D. Requirements
Padlocking provisions on front or back of door with safety release on
opposite side. (Specify which side with locking.) Safety
release feature permits door hardware to be released, thus minimizing
possibility of personnel being locked in room.
